Hello Mirek
the volumes are a part of the reading room collection of the library of our military academy, and I don’t have now time to visit there to consult them. A couple decades ago I got copies on a few pages of that volume, mainly on those which cover the 7./8.8.1941 attack.

Only other info from the book I have
In der Nacht zum 11. Aug 41 von 23.28 bis 02.27 Uhr flogen 11 russische Fligzeuge aus Danziger Bucht kommend in das Reichsgebiet ein. Eindringtiefe Schwiebusch-Forst-Finsterwalde-Wurzen-Schweidnitz. Ein feindliches Flugzeug berührte bei Ausflug auf Nordkurs Berlin ohne Bombenabwurf. There were bomb damages around Guben. Ein Flugzeug landete Nähe Minensperre bei Pillau not.

In der Nacht zum 12. Aug einige Feindflugzeuge ein in den Raum Demin-Neustrelitz-Nauen-Wittenberg-Kottbus-Krossen-Grünberg-Hohensalza-Tilsit. Nur zwei Flugzeuge erreichten die aussere Flakzone Berlins in der Gegend Oranienburg. Ein weiteres Flugzeug umflog Berlin. Die eingeflogenen Flugzeuge warfen keine Bomben.

Hi Juha
Nice but something strange data about Soviet attack on Berlin?

There were following dates of Soviet air attacks

1. 7/8.08,
2. 8/9.08,
3. 11/12.08
4. 15/16.08
5. 18/19.08

plus 4 more.

From the third attack Soviet had used aditional DBA's bombers of 40 DBAD - next 12 DB-3 and DB-3F had landed on Aste airfield. On the night 11/12.08 such bombers were despached against Berlin too.

Bombers from 1. MTA had attacked other target, not Berlin this night.

Second strange, but only the first night Soviet had reported a loss of one bomber crew and up to 15/16.08 they did not recored any more own losses including DBA unit too.

I have just forgotten but on 10/11.08 was done other, rather tragic attak of TB-7 and Yer-2 of 432. TBAP and 420. DBAP. According Soviets only 4 TB-7 and 2 Yer-2 had got over Berlin. Crews had took off near Leningrad.
